The NC State Wolfpack (9-6, 2-2 ACC) will host the North Carolina Tar Heels (10-6, 3-1 ACC) after winning four home games in a row. The matchup tips at 4:00 PM ET on Saturday, January 11, 2025.

North Carolina vs. NC State Stat Insights
Points
- The 84.4 points the Tar Heels average are 17.5 more than the Wolfpack give up.
- North Carolina is 10-6 when putting more than 66.9 points on the board.
- NC State has a 9-6 record when allowing fewer than 84.4 points.
- The Wolfpack's 72.5 points per game are 5.9 fewer than the Tar Heels allow.
- NC State is 6-0 when posting over 78.4 points.
- North Carolina's record is 5-0 when it gives up less than 72.5 points.
- The Tar Heels have outscored opponents by 96 points this season (six per game), and the Wolfpack have scored 84 more than their opponents (5.6 per game).
Shooting
- The Tar Heels shoot 47.4% from the field, 3.4% higher than the Wolfpack concede defensively.
- North Carolina has an 8-2 straight-up record when shooting higher than 44% from the field.
- The Wolfpack make 45.7% of their shots from the field, 3.3% higher than the Tar Heels' defensive field-goal percentage.
- NC State is 8-3 straight up when shooting higher than 42.4% from the field.

Rebounding
- The Tar Heels average 34.4 rebounds, better than the Wolfpack by 4.3 boards per game.
- North Carolina is 7-1 overall when tops in terms of rebounding. NC State is 3-5 when coming up short on the glass.
- The Tar Heels average 7.6 offensive rebounds, 1.8 less than the Wolfpack.
- The Wolfpack are 3-3 overall when they win the battle on the offensive glass. The Tar Heels are 4-4 when they fall short there.
